Switching to Linux: Easy Steps for Windows Users

Table of Contents

  1. Introduction
  2. Why Switch to Linux?
    • Security and Privacy
    • Cost-Effectiveness
    • Customization and Flexibility
  3. Preparing for the Switch
    • Researching Linux Distributions
    • Backing Up Your Data
    • Creating a Bootable USB Drive
  4. Installing Linux
    • Downloading a Linux Distribution
    • Booting from the USB Drive
    • Installing Linux alongside Windows
    • Removing Windows Completely
  5. Getting Started with Linux
    • Navigating the Linux Desktop Environment
    • Installing Essential Software
    • Setting Up Drivers and Hardware
  6. Common Challenges and Solutions
    • Solving Hardware Compatibility Issues
    • Finding Alternatives to Windows Software
    • Learning Linux Commands (Basics)
  7. Tips for a Smooth Transition
    • Joining Linux Communities
    • Utilizing Online Resources and Tutorials
    • Regularly Updating Your System
  8. Conclusion

Introduction

How to switch from Windows to Linux ? Switching from Windows to Linux can seem daunting at first, but it’s a journey worth taking for many users. Whether you're driven by a desire for greater security, more customization options, or just a free operating system, Linux offers a variety of benefits. This guide will walk you through the process step-by-step, ensuring a smooth transition to Linux for Windows users.

Why Switch to Linux?

Security and Privacy

Linux is known for its strong security features. Unlike Windows, Linux is less susceptible to viruses and malware, making it a safer option for daily use. Additionally, Linux respects user privacy, providing a transparent environment without intrusive data collection.

Cost-Effectiveness

Linux is an open-source operating system, which means it’s free to download and use. This can save you a significant amount of money compared to purchasing a Windows license.

Customization and Flexibility

Linux offers unparalleled customization options. Users can tweak almost every aspect of the operating system, from the desktop environment to the kernel. This flexibility allows users to create a system that perfectly suits their needs and preferences.

Preparing for the Switch

Researching Linux Distributions

Linux comes in many different flavors, known as distributions (distros). Some of the most popular ones include Ubuntu, Fedora, and Linux Mint. Researching and choosing the right distro for your needs is an important first step. For beginners, Ubuntu and Linux Mint are often recommended due to their user-friendly interfaces and large support communities.

Backing Up Your Data

Before making any changes to your system, it’s crucial to back up all important data. Use an external hard drive, cloud storage, or any reliable backup method to ensure your files are safe.

Creating a Bootable USB Drive

To install Linux, you’ll need a bootable USB drive. This involves downloading an ISO file of your chosen Linux distro and using a tool like Rufus or Etcher to create the bootable drive. This will allow you to install Linux on your computer.

Installing Linux

Downloading a Linux Distribution

Visit the official website of your chosen Linux distro and download the latest ISO file. This file contains the entire operating system and is essential for the installation process.

Booting from the USB Drive

Insert the bootable USB drive into your computer and restart it. You may need to change the boot order in your BIOS/UEFI settings to boot from the USB drive. Once your computer boots from the USB, you’ll be presented with the option to try Linux or install it.

Installing Linux alongside Windows

If you’re not ready to completely abandon Windows, you can install Linux alongside it in a dual-boot setup. This allows you to choose between Linux and Windows each time you start your computer. During the installation process, select the option to install Linux alongside Windows.

Removing Windows Completely

If you’re ready to fully switch to Linux, you can choose to remove Windows completely during the installation process. This will free up all your computer’s resources for Linux, but make sure you’ve backed up your data before proceeding.

Getting Started with Linux

Navigating the Linux Desktop Environment

Once Linux is installed, spend some time exploring the desktop environment. Linux offers various desktop environments such as GNOME, KDE, and XFCE, each with its own look and feel. Familiarize yourself with the basic navigation, file management, and settings.

Installing Essential Software

Linux has its own software ecosystem, with many applications available through package managers like APT (for Debian-based distros) or YUM (for Red Hat-based distros). Install essential software such as web browsers, office suites, and media players through the software center or terminal.

Setting Up Drivers and Hardware

Linux has excellent hardware support, but you might need to install additional drivers for certain components like graphics cards or printers. Use the driver manager or check your distro’s documentation for instructions on installing necessary drivers.

Common Challenges and Solutions

Solving Hardware Compatibility Issues

While Linux supports a wide range of hardware, you might encounter compatibility issues with certain devices. Check the Linux compatibility lists and forums for solutions. Often, installing the correct drivers or tweaking settings can resolve these issues.

Finding Alternatives to Windows Software

Many popular Windows applications have Linux alternatives. For example, GIMP can replace Photoshop, LibreOffice can replace Microsoft Office, and VLC can replace Windows Media Player. Explore the software repositories and community recommendations to find suitable replacements.

Learning Linux Commands (Basics)

While you can do most tasks in Linux through the graphical interface, learning some basic Linux commands can be incredibly useful. Commands like ls, cd, cp, and mv can help you navigate and manage your files more efficiently.

Tips for a Smooth Transition

Joining Linux Communities

Joining online forums and communities like Ubuntu Forums, Reddit’s r/linux, or Linux Mint Community can provide invaluable support. These communities are filled with experienced users who can help you troubleshoot issues and share tips.

Utilizing Online Resources and Tutorials

There are numerous online resources, tutorials, and courses available for learning Linux. Websites like YouTube, Linux Academy, and Codecademy offer free and paid content to help you master Linux.

Regularly Updating Your System

Keep your Linux system up to date by regularly installing updates. This ensures you have the latest security patches, bug fixes, and software improvements. Most Linux distros have a built-in update manager that makes this process straightforward.

Conclusion

Switching from Windows to Linux can be a rewarding experience, offering greater security, customization, and cost savings. By following these steps, you can make the transition smoothly and start enjoying the benefits of Linux. Remember to back up your data, choose the right distro, and take advantage of the numerous resources and communities available to help you on your Linux journey. With a little patience and exploration, you’ll soon feel at home in the world of Linux.